Armored thermocouple cable

Armored thermocouple cable, commonly known as armored wire, also known as inorganic insulated thermocouple cable internationally, is a solid whole made of stainless steel protective tube, magnesium oxide insulation powder, thermocouple wire material combined and compacted by mold. It has the advantages of pressure resistance, earthquake resistance, flexibility, miniaturization, and fast thermal response time, and is the core material for manufacturing armored thermocouples.

Product standards

1. Low cost metal armored thermocouple cables comply with JB/T 8205-1999 and GB/T 18404-2001

2. Precious metal armored thermocouple cables comply with JB/T 8909-1999

3. Armored Platinum Rhodium 30-Platinum Rhodium 8 Thermocouple Cable Execution QB/T 2405-2004

Thermoelectric characteristics and tolerances

Armored thermocouples made of different types of armored thermocouple cables should comply with GB/T 16839.1-1997 "Thermocouples Part 1: Scale Table" when the reference end is 0 ℃, and the allowable tolerances for different grades should comply with the provisions of Table 1-3.

insulation resistance

The insulation resistance should be measured between the wires and between the wires and the outer sleeve. For cables with an outer diameter ≤ 1.5mm, the voltage used is 75 ± 25Vd. c, and for cables with an outer diameter>1.5mm, the voltage used is 500 ± 50Vd. c. The insulation resistance per meter at room temperature and high temperature shall comply with the provisions of Table 1-4.
